Height of group of 20 boys aged 10 years was 140 ± 13 cm and 20 girls of same age was 135 cm ± 7 cm. To test the statistical significance of difference in height, test applicable is -
High-Yield Explanation
Student’s t-test:
– Paired Student’s t-test: Comparing means (± SD) in paired data (in same group of individuals before and after an intervention)
– Unpaired Student’s t-test: Comparing means (± SD) in two different group of individuals
– Z-test: Is a variant of student’s t-test which is used when sample size is > 30.
In the given question, mean ± SD of 20 boys (140 ± 13 cm) and 20 girls (135 cm ± 7cm) of the same age are compared, Thus most appropriate statistical test of significance would be Unpaired Student’s t-test.
